Smoke due oil is blue and not so volatiles
most of the smoke ppl report is bc cold catalyzers basically temp and humidity parameters
early series spray differently on valves oil at start
but i wouldnt see it as an issue
overall all the high hp /liter na dfi engines need to be warmed properly avoiding cold start and after a couple of miles a switch off before engines having reached their working temp
